#a22980 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a22980 is composed of 63.5% red, 16.1%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.7% magenta, 21%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 316.9 degrees, a saturation of 59.6% and a lightness of 39.8%. #a22980 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#450001.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#a22980 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a22980 has RGB values of R:162, G:41,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.21,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10627456.

Shades and Tints of #a22980
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050104 is the darkest color, while #fcf5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a22980
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6068 is the less saturated color, while #c90291 is the most saturated one.
